The song was praised by critics upon its release, and gave Adams one of his best chart performances, his most highly successful being the 1991 international chart-topping hit "(Everything I Do) I Do It For You". The single reached number two in the UK, number seven in the US, and number one in Australia, Canada, Norway, Ireland and Belgium. Adams told Songfacts that it was one of the first songs that he agreed to use a modulation in. The song has an instrumental intro, which is only found on the album version of the song.
